I am a Registered Massage Therapist (RMT) and graduate of the West Coast College of Massage Therapy (Class of 2020). My practice is grounded in a client-centered approach that integrates therapeutic and relaxation techniques to support overall health, mobility, and well-being. Each treatment is tailored to address individual goals — whether that involves reducing muscle tension, improving range of motion, assisting with injury recovery, or managing chronic pain. I incorporate a variety of techniques into my treatments, including fascial work, as well as passive and active techniques, to target specific concerns and support functional movement. By combining evidence-informed therapeutic methods with calming relaxation techniques, my goal is to provide treatments that are both effective and restorative, helping clients achieve optimal physical function and an improved quality of life.
